#f5d8b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5d8b4 is composed of 96.1% red, 84.7%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 26.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 33.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 83.3%. #f5d8b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ebb169.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#f5d8b4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f5d8b4 has RGB values of R:245, G:216,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.27,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16111796.

Shades and Tints of #f5d8b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0702 is the darkest color, while #fefcf9 is the lightest one.
